|
Страници по тази тема: 1 | 2 | >> (покажи всички)
Тема
|
e-mail+atachment?
|
|
Автор |
БaбaИлиицa (непознат) |
Публикувано | 26.02.01 00:30 |
|
как може да се атачне файл, към поща изпратена от скрипт, преди време, се дискутира тоя въпрос в клубчето html и web дизайн, ама не го намерих... Ако някой знае как, да каже...
Благодаря, баба...
________________________________
Само си поклащам краката!
| |
|
Какъв точно файл?
т.е. откъде ще го взимаш.
Потребителят чрез форма ли ще ти го изпраща или от директориите някъде?
Математиката се състои от очевидни неща подредени по подходящ начин
| |
|
Ами и за двете, то технологически не би трябвало да има особена разлика, аз като имам файла (в бинарен или текстов формат, зависи от файла), атачването му е едно и също... значе, да предположим, че файла е на моя хост- отварям го и го прочетам, записвам го в един клар, след това принтам главата на мейла (до кого е, от кого е и т.н.) след това, принтам самия мейл (текста на писмото) и след това, по някакъв начин се добавя и файла, който в последствие ще пристигне като атачмънт... Е точно това ме интересува...
Баба...
________________________________
Само си поклащам краката!
| |
|
аха,
т.е. искаш да пристига като атачмънт...хмм не зная наистина, не съм се замислял по въпроса. Може би е нещо сходно на linux команда за испращане на атачмънт. Говоря за командата mail под linux. Обаче не и знам параметрите. Ако искаш пробвай в linux : man mail
Може би ще откриеш нещо...
Математиката се състои от очевидни неща подредени по подходящ начин
| |
|
Ами, аз знам, че има начин, въпроса е как точно става номера? Имам едно такова предложение, че се пише след всичката патаклама с хедъра на писмото и текста му, следното: print "Content-type: .../...; atachment;"; или беше нещо такова, и след това се добавя: print "..."; и принташ каквото има във файла... бинерни или текст...
Баба...
________________________________
Само си поклащам краката!
| |
|
ot PERL script:
`metasend -b -D Name -S 2048000 -F Mail_From -e base64
-f File_Name -s \"Subject\" -t To
-m application\/octet-stream\\;name=\\"File.exe\\"`
'man metasend' i vij koe kakvo e.
Редактирано от Дизeлджия на 26.02.01 10:54.
| |
|
From: <virus@mail.bg>
To: <nqm@m.si>
Subject: NEma
Date: Mon, 26 Feb 2001 13:59:29 +0100
MIME-Version: 1.0
Content-Type: multipart/mixed;
boundary="----=_NextPart_000_001D_01C09FFC.564AEDE0"
X-Priority: 3
X-MSMail-Priority: Normal
X-Mailer: Microsoft Outlook Express 5.50.4133.2400
X-MimeOLE: Produced By Microsoft MimeOLE V5.50.4133.2400
This is a multi-part message in MIME format.
------=_NextPart_000_001D_01C09FFC.564AEDE0
Content-Type: multipart/alternative;
boundary="----=_NextPart_001_001E_01C09FFC.565415A0"
------=_NextPart_001_001E_01C09FFC.565415A0
Content-Type: text/plain;
charset="windows-1251"
Content-Transfer-Encoding: quoted-printable
bla bla
------=_NextPart_001_001E_01C09FFC.565415A0
Content-Type: text/html;
charset="windows-1251"
Content-Transfer-Encoding: quoted-printable
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META http-equiv=3DContent-Type content=3D"text/html; =
charset=3Dwindows-1251">
<META content=3D"MSHTML 5.50.4134.600" name=3DGENERATOR>
<STYLE></STYLE>
</HEAD>
<BODY bgColor=3D#ffffff>
<DIV><FONT size=3D2>bla bla</FONT></DIV></BODY></HTML>
------=_NextPart_001_001E_01C09FFC.565415A0--
------=_NextPart_000_001D_01C09FFC.564AEDE0
Content-Type: application/octet-stream;
name="Perl.log"
Content-Transfer-Encoding: 7bit
Content-Disposition: attachment;
filename="Perl.log"
Download is Started (22:25, February 25, 2001)
Download is Completed (22:26, February 25, 2001)
Summary:
Number of Files: 1 Total Size: 7.4 KB
------=_NextPart_000_001D_01C09FFC.564AEDE0--
Come crawling faster
Obey your Master
Your life burns faster
Obey your Master
Master
| |
|
Or mail --?
JAVA lets make things badly and slow!!
| |
|
зависи от файла. ако е текстов - може направо да го закачиш.
# mail user@domain -s "subject" < /tmp/file.txt
ако не - трябва да го прекараш през uuencode или mimencode
# zip /tmp/file /directory/* -q
# uuencode /tmp/file.zip file.zip | mail user@domain -s "subject"
# rm -f /tmp/file.zip
TANSTAAFL! There AiNt Such Thing As A Free Lunch
| |
Тема
|
Re: e-mail+atachment?
[re: БaбaИлиицa]
|
|
Автор | nickyk (Нерегистриран) |
Публикувано | 17.03.01 03:45 |
|
ima edna programka metasend s edna kamara opcii - varshi chudesna rabota v pochti vsiaka situacia
inache ne pomnia tochno a i me marzi da pogledna kakvi vazmozhnosti imashe Mail::Send - vizh i nego ako ne te marzi kato mene
| |
|
Страници по тази тема: 1 | 2 | >> (покажи всички)
|
|
|